I used to love this store when it was located on Hwy 10. It seems that since the store was moved to a larger location and into Plover I've had a hard time getting any credit or finding any clothes, as if they're too picky. I took in a Jumperoo (highly desired) and some 3T pants. They didn't take any of the pants, really didn't give a reason, but upon looking thru the store I'm almost thankful because I think they had one pair of pants in a 5T. I spoke to a woman looking for 3T and told her I just brought in a bunch, but bummer, when I took back their rejects all these pants that I don't even think were worn were still there. Plus, they took a cleaning deduction on the bouncer; I think the kid I babysat used it like twice since I had completely cleaned the thing and that isn't an easy feat with the nooks and crannies, the only droplets I saw were probably from another child's sippy cup while entertaining the baby. So, I've decided that my 95% relied upon store is going way down the list; I'll take and go Nice as New, it may not be immediate cash/credit, but I rarely walk out of there without a purchased bag!
